Argentina Dominant in 2-0 Victory Over Canada in Copa América Opener

Messi Leads Defending Champions to Early Win

Canada Impresses Despite Loss

Argentina, the defending Copa América champions, kicked off their title defense with a dominant 2-0 victory over Canada on Thursday night. Lionel Messi played a key role in the win, setting up the opening goal and scoring the second.

Argentina started the match strongly, but it was Canada who had the best chance of the opening half. Alphonso Davies found himself in space inside the Argentina penalty area, but his shot was well saved by Emiliano Martínez. Canada goalkeeper Maxime Crépeau also made several impressive saves to keep Argentina at bay.

Argentina eventually broke the deadlock in the 59th minute. Messi found Ángel Di María with a through ball, and Di María rounded Crépeau to slot home the opening goal. Messi then sealed the victory in the 83rd minute, finishing off a counterattack with a clinical strike.

Despite the loss, Canada impressed in their Copa América debut. They defended resolutely for long periods and created several good chances of their own. They will be hoping to build on this performance when they face Uruguay in their next match on Monday.
